The Neighborhood Domain will Quickly Improve your Modeling Skills

Microservices are about domain decomposition. This decomposition allows code to be deployed that is more isolated, durable, resilient, and launched in a compute form factor designed for the requirements. In addition, the isolation allows for teams to move on their deployment schedules and cadences. These reasons are attractive, but they do come with domain complexity that often manifests itself as architectural complexity. And while I can’t remove the architectural complexity, I do want to offer an approach to domain modeling that will feel more familiar. Introducing the neighborhood domain.
